Shopping Addiction Fueled By Online Shopping

Online Shopping Is Impacting Rates and Severity Of Online Shopping As the holiday season ends and a new year begins, many have stopped spending tons of money shopping for presents and are letting their wallets rest. Unfortunately, many others will struggle with compulsive shopping, commonly referred to as “buying-shopping disorder” (BSD). BSD is not officially recognized as a stand-alone diagnosis, but it has attracted the attention of many behavioral and addiction specialists. The issue was first described by a German psychiatrist as “buying mania” around 100 years ago and is now estimated to affect around 5% of the population worldwide. Is Shopping Addiction Real? Having a shopping spree every now and then is not the same as having a shopping addiction. Over-shopping or overspending can happen to anyone, but BSD is characterized by the extreme craving to shop for or seek consumer goods. People with BSD use shopping as a coping mechanism to regulate emotions by either getting pleasure or relief after shopping. Those addicted to shopping will often spend more than they can afford and experience post-purchase guilt and may even shop more to feel better, creating a vicious cycle. Online shopping mania

Southeast Asia, including the Philippines, has become a virtual gold mine for online shopping. Proof of this is that many online shopping malls are now on expansion mode. Lazada, Southeast Asia’s largest online shopping website, has just announced that it has raised $250 million from a group of investors including Tesco PLC, Access Industries, Investment AB Kinnevik and Verlinvest. This marks the first investment by multichannel retailer Tesco into a pure online player in the region. According to Tesco, as South East Asia’s 600 million consumers begin to use smartphone technology to access retailers online, Lazada has established a strong position from which to grow. Lazada is a pioneer in Southeast Asian e-commerce with around 1,500 employees across five Southeast Asian countries including the Philippines, Malaysia and Thailand.Just recently, it launched Lamido in Indonesia and Vietnam to tap into the large informal e-commerce market of C2C transactions which includes thousands of shops on social networks such as Facebook. Zalora, an online fashion start up, was also able to raise P4.9 billion in new funds. According to the Philippine Retailers Association (PRA), online shopping holds potential for retailers in the Philippines. Although less than three percent of Filipinos shop online, the PRA has been pushing e-commerce as a new avenue for retailers. Essay on Online Shopping for all Class in 100 to 500 Words in English

Online shopping in simple words: The form of shopping in which people can easily purchase goods and services by using the internet is called online shopping. Online shopping gives us an idea of the availability of everything online at a cost of our data. Online shopping is a growing and trending aspect. It provides customers with buying various products and services, and sellers to carry on their business and transactions in an online mode. It is time saving and convenient way of shopping. It can be said that it is the development of traditional shopping ways to make shopping more accessible, relaxing, and flexible.
